This groundbreaking energy project aligns with Cargill’s global commitment to sustainable food processing and the adoption of environmentally friendly, renewable energy solutions for industrial production. By advancing Cargill’s sustainability goals, the project enhances safety while providing a cost-effective, long-term energy solution.

Designed, supplied, and installed by Dutch & Company (Gh) Ltd., the fully automated, digital PV solar system will generate 764MWh of clean electricity annually to support operations at the Tema Factory. Beyond reducing energy costs, this initiative reinforces Ghana’s vision of achieving a 10% renewable energy contribution to the national electricity mix. The solar plant’s output is equivalent to powering nearly 400 homes each year, ensuring a lasting impact on both industry and community sustainability.
